Vasse Felix replaces Heytesbury with new icon

Margaret River estate, Vasse Felix, has announced it is to replace its top red wine ‘Heytesbury’ with a new ‘icon’ using vines planted by its founder. The ‘Tom Cullity’ – named after the winery’s founder Dr Tom Cullity – is a Cabernet Sauvignon and Malbec blend, with the fruit coming from the estate’s “home” vineyard which includes the first vines planted by Cullity in 1967.
